That’s where massage therapy comes in. While most people think of massage as a way to relax, it actually does much more than that. Massage is a powerful tool that can activate the body’s natural ability to heal, not just physically, but emotionally and mentally too.
When we get a massage, the gentle pressure and movement help improve blood flow and loosen tight muscles. This encourages the body to let go of stored tension — kind of like hitting the reset button. As muscles relax, the nervous system also starts to calm down. You may notice your breathing slows, your heart rate drops, and your mind starts to clear. It’s your body’s way of saying, “I feel safe now. I can heal.”
Regular massage doesn’t just provide short-term relief; it supports long-term wellness. It can help with things like improving sleep, boosting immunity, reducing anxiety, and even increasing focus. By improving circulation and lowering stress hormones, massage allows the body to repair itself more efficiently. Over time, this leads to better energy, fewer aches and pains, and an overall sense of balance.
